Comparative analysis of energy indicators in schools in the territory of the city of Kragujevac

After the Government of Republic of Serbia has adopted the Law on efficient consumption of energy, energy managers in local governments will be responsible for proposing and implementing measures for efficient energy consumption. Schools, as large energy consumers, become very important from that ascpect. The comfort of children is another important issue, because schools in Kragujevac are located in buildings which were constructed from the end of 19. century to the end of 20. century, so they mainly have old doors and windows and lack insulation. The paper includes energy consumption analysis for schools in the city of Kragujevac. The data shown in the paper were collected in the period 2006 - 2012, for 22 elementary schools. The data on energy consumption, area of the buildings, number of students, number of classrooms, type and year of construction, type and price of fuel, as well as number of work days were analized for these facilities. Kragujevac schools are heated using the thermal energy coming from district heating system, electrical energy and solid fuel (coal and wood). The thermal energy from district heating system is still charged using a flat rate, according to area, and not according to actual consumption. In the last couple of years, control measurement of supplied energy had been done in several schools by the public company supplying the thermal energy, so it is possible to calculate thermal energy consumption indicators in those schools. Where it was possible, specific heat and electrical energy consumption indices were calculated.
